Cleaning device and detection equipment
By designing a cleaning device that includes first and second cleaning mechanisms, the problem of incomplete local cleaning of products was solved, achieving comprehensive cleaning of the back cover of mobile phones and improving detection accuracy.

[0001] This application belongs to the field of automation equipment technology, and in particular relates to a cleaning device and a testing device. Background Technology
[0002] With the widespread use of 3C products, consumers have increasingly higher demands for products with undamaged appearances. Therefore, manufacturers must promptly identify and address any appearance defects during the production of each product. Typically, products undergo rigorous appearance inspection after each manufacturing process.
[0003] Taking the back cover of a mobile phone as an example, before testing the back cover, the surface of the product needs to be cleaned to avoid the dirt on the product surface affecting the test results.
[0004] Currently, product surfaces are typically only cleaned as a whole, and areas with protrusions or depressions cannot be completely cleaned. Utility Model Content

[0061] The products mentioned in the embodiments of this application can be mobile phone back covers 200, mobile phone frames, tablet back covers, tablet frames, or shells or components of other devices, whether installed or not.
[0062] This application uses the outer surface of the mobile phone back cover 200 after cleaning and installation as an example. The mobile phone back cover 200 includes an outer surface and a camera hole formed on the outer surface. After the mobile phone back cover 200 is installed, the camera is installed into the camera hole and protrudes from the outer surface of the mobile phone back cover 200. The outer periphery of the protruding part of the camera needs to be cleaned. The outer surface of the mobile phone back cover 200 is the first region 201, and the outer periphery of the protruding part of the camera is the second region 202.
[0063] like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the cleaning device 100 includes a first cleaning mechanism 1, a second cleaning mechanism 2, and a transfer mechanism 5. The second cleaning mechanism 2 is disposed on one side of the first cleaning mechanism 1. It can be understood that the first cleaning mechanism 1 and the second cleaning mechanism 2 are spaced apart along the X direction. The first cleaning mechanism 1 is used to clean the first area 201, and the second cleaning mechanism 2 is used to clean the second area 202. The mobile phone back cover 200 is placed on the transfer mechanism 5. The transfer mechanism 5 can be located below the first cleaning mechanism 1 in the Z direction. When the transfer mechanism 5 is located below the first cleaning mechanism 1, the first cleaning mechanism 1 cleans the first area 201. After the mobile phone back cover 200 is cleaned by the first cleaning mechanism 1, the transfer mechanism 5 is located below the second cleaning mechanism 2 in the Z direction, and the second cleaning mechanism 2 cleans the second area 202.
[0064] The cleaning device 100 of this application cleans the first area 201 of the back cover 200 of the mobile phone through the first cleaning mechanism 1. For the protruding part of the back cover 200, namely the second area 202, the first cleaning mechanism 1 cannot clean it accurately. The second cleaning mechanism 2 can clean the second area 202 of the back cover 200 of the mobile phone. Therefore, the cleaning effect of the back cover 200 of the mobile phone can be improved by using the first cleaning mechanism 1 and the second cleaning mechanism 2, so as to improve the accuracy of subsequent detection.

[0068] The first cleaning component 122 includes a brush 1222 and a spray pipe 1221. The spray pipe 1221 can spray wiping liquid onto the first wiping cloth section 115. The brush 1222 contacts the first wiping cloth section 115 and abuts against the mobile phone back cover 200 carried on the transfer mechanism 5, thereby cleaning the first area 201. By spraying wiping liquid, the cleaning effect on the first area 201 can be improved.
[0069] The wiping solution can be alcohol or water; the first wiping cloth can be a lint-free cloth.

[0078] In one alternative embodiment, the second wiping assembly 22 further includes a spray element 222, and the second cleaning element 221 is disposed adjacent to the spray element 222.
[0079] like Figure 5 As shown, the second wiping assembly 22 also includes a spraying component 222, which sprays wiping liquid onto the second wiping cloth segment 215. The second cleaning component 221 contacts the second wiping cloth segment 215 to clean the second area 202. By spraying wiping liquid, the cleaning effect on the second area 202 can be improved. After the back cover 200 of the mobile phone is cleaned at the second wiping assembly 22, the transfer mechanism 5 moves the back cover 200 of the mobile phone to the third wiping assembly 23. It should be noted that the second wiping cloth is movable. After the second wiping assembly 22 finishes wiping, the second wiping cloth is released again. At this time, the second wiping cloth segment 215 is free of wiping liquid. The third cleaning component 231 cleans the second area 202 again through the second wiping cloth segment 215 without wiping liquid, which can dry the wiping liquid and avoid wiping liquid residue, thereby improving the cleaning effect.
[0080] The wiping solution can be alcohol or water; the second wiping cloth can be a lint-free cloth.
[0081] In a preferred embodiment, the fourth material shaft 212 is close to the third wiping component 23 and the second wiping component 22. The third material shaft 211 is an unwinding shaft and a rewinding shaft. Therefore, the conveying direction of the second wiping cloth is opposite to the moving direction of the mobile phone back cover 200, which can improve the utilization rate of the second wiping cloth and avoid waste.

[0086] In another specific embodiment, the first cleaning head is made of silicone, and the second cleaning head is an airbag cleaning head. This embodiment will be used as an example for explanation; the first cleaning head is made of silicone, which provides better cleaning performance, reaching deep into small crevices and corners. Silicone is also less prone to attracting dust and dirt, resulting in longer-lasting cleaning. Furthermore, silicone is easy to clean and maintain. The second cleaning head is an airbag cleaning head, which has good cushioning and elasticity, allowing it to better conform to the cleaning surface and providing better cleaning performance for uneven or irregular surfaces.

[0095] In one specific embodiment, the third cleaning mechanism 3 is used to blow ordinary air to remove dust from the mobile phone back cover 200 located on the feeding mechanism 6; the fourth cleaning mechanism 4 is used to blow ion air to remove static electricity from the mobile phone back cover 200 located on the holding assembly 71.
[0096] In another embodiment, the third cleaning mechanism 3 is used to blow ionizing air to remove static electricity from the phone back cover 200 located on the loading mechanism 6; the fourth cleaning mechanism 4 is used to blow ordinary air to remove dust from the phone back cover 200 located on the holding assembly 71. In this embodiment, removing static electricity from the phone back cover 200 before dust removal avoids static electricity attracting dust, thereby improving the cleaning effect.

[0106] Since the conveying mechanism 7 can only move one mobile phone back cover 200 at a time on the loading mechanism 6, a first buffer component 53 is provided. After the conveying mechanism 7 moves the mobile phone back cover 200 multiple times, it is placed on the first buffer component 53. After multiple mobile phone back covers 200 are placed on the first buffer component 53, the first buffer component 53 moves along the X direction to below the second conveying component 56. At the same time, the second conveying component 56 removes the multiple mobile phone back covers 200 located on the first buffer component 53. The first buffer component 53 returns to below the conveying mechanism 7 to continue loading. At this time, the first carrier component 51 moves to below the second conveying component 56, and the second conveying component 56 places multiple mobile phone back covers 200 simultaneously into multiple first carriers 511, with one mobile phone back cover 200 placed in each first carrier 511. In this embodiment, by setting the first buffer component 53 and the second conveying component 56, the loading efficiency can be improved.
